Transaction 2c6578cf29310e3f282ff942da8f760529cc3156d2d7bb1352003c76a5181585
2 Input
2 Outputs
- 2c6578cf29310e3f282ff942da8f760529cc3156d2d7bb1352003c76a5181585:0
- 2c6578cf29310e3f282ff942da8f760529cc3156d2d7bb1352003c76a5181585:1
value 696915
address 1NT7ZHgVs86pjai4LiBbir2tbhdxpyQg6F
value 22122823
address 126ntmHEv8RCjASf8aD1vfTh9oEbmbdYi6